[SHOT 2026] New Diamondback Firearms Ventra Suppressor Lineup

Diamondback Firearms just dropped a bombshell at SHOT Show 2026, storming into the suppressor arena with their Ventra lineup—a trio of cans that hit the sweet spots for 5.56 NATO, .30 caliber, and rimfire shooters. This isn’t some tentative toe-dip; it’s a full-throttle launch from a company that’s already proven its mettle with innovative revolvers unveiled two years ago. The Ventra series promises lightweight titanium construction, user-serviceable designs for easy cleaning, and aggressive baffle tech optimized for minimal first-round pop and backpressure, all while keeping prices competitive (rumored under $800 for the rimfire model). In a market dominated by big dogs like SilencerCo and Dead Air, Diamondback’s move screams ambition: they’re not just making noise, they’re engineering silence with a focus on affordability and reliability that could disrupt the entry-level segment.
